Latest Timeline for Royal Caribbean’s Pier and Attractions Opening on Their Private Island

Royal Caribbean has updated the timelime for the opening of the pier and attractions (Perfect Day) that the cruise line is building on their private island in the Bahamas, CocoCay.

Royal Caribbean is transforming CocoCay into the “Perfect Day” for cruisers that includes the tallest waterslide in North America, over the water cabanas, zip lines, the biggest wave pool in the Caribbean, a helium balloon that will rise 450 feet in the air, and the largest freshwater pool in the Caribbean.  In addition to these new attractions, Royal Caribbean is building a much needed pier on the island that will eliminate the need for tendering from cruise ships.

The projects open in phases and the latest timeline is as follows:

  • The new pier will begin welcoming guests to the island in March 2019
  • Thrill Waterpark, the Zip Line, Splashaway Bay aqua park, Up, Up and Away helium balloon, Captain Jack’s Galleon, Skipper’s Grill dining, Captain Jack’s dining, Chill Island, Chill Grill dining, and Oasis Lagoon freshwater pool will open in May 2019.
  • South Beach, Coco Beach Club and the overwater cabanas will open in December 2019

These dates are subject to change depending on the process of construction.

What will be complimentary and what will come with an added surcharge? Splashaway Bay, Captains Jack’s Galleon, Oasis Lagoon, Chill Island, and South Beach will all be included in cruise fares. Free dining options will be Skipper’s Grill, Chill Grill, and Snack Shack.

Thrill Waterpark  will cost $44-$99 per person for a full day or $39-$74 for a half day (PM only).  Thrill Waterpark includes 13 waterslides, Wave Pool, Adventure Pool, beach chairs, towels, and dining at Snack Shack.

The zip line will cost $79-$139 per person.  If you package the zip line with Thrill Waterpark, the price will be $99-$179 per person.

Coco Beach Club includes access to an exclusive beach, club house, and infinity pool.  The price is $54-$99 per person for ages 13 and older.  Kids 4-12 will cost $34-$69 each.  Ages three and under will be complimentary.

Captain Jack’s will feature an a al carte dining menu.

There will also be five different types of cabanas that will hold anywhere from six to eight guests.  The pricing is as follows:

  • Chill Island Cabanas – $299-$569
  • Oasis Lagoon Cabanas – $299-$569
  • Thrill Waterpark Cabanas – $499-$869
  • Coco Beach Club Beach Cabanas – $949-$1,549
  • Coco Beach Club Overwater Cabanas – $999-$1,599

Prices will vary by season.
